Exports and imports of goods, May 2025, in current prices and in constant prices

Weak rise for imports of goods in May compared with April

Statistical news from Statistics Sweden 2025-07-28 8.00

In May, exports of goods decreased by 10 percent in value and by 1 percent in volume compared with the same period last year. At the same time, imports of goods decreased by 7 percent in value while they increased by 1 percent in volume.

- Exports of petroleum products decreased in both value and volume compared with last year and last month, says Kajsa Krol Brevinge, statistician at Statistics Sweden.

Compared with the previous month, Swedish exports of goods remained unchanged in value while they increased by 1 percent in volume. Swedish imports of goods increased by 1 percent in value and by 2 percent in volume compared with the previous month. The number of weekdays in May 2025 was the same as in April 2025.

Exports of mineral fuels and electric current decreased by 24 percent in value and by 4 percent in volume compared with the same period last year. Within this product area, export of petroleum products decreased by 30 percent in value and by 8 percent in volume. Compared with the previous month, exports of petroleum products decreased by 9 percent in value and by 6 percent in volume.

Exports of chemicals/rubber products decreased by 13 percent in value and by 5 percent in volume compared with the same period last year. Within this product area, export of pharmaceutical products decreased by 21 percent in value and by 13 percent in volume. Compared with the previous month, exports of pharmaceutical products decreased by 9 percent in value and by 6 percent in volume.

Exports of machinery and transport equipment decreased by 8 percent in value while they remained unchanged in volume compared with the same period last year. Within this product area, exports of passenger cars decreased by 29 percent in value and by 23 percent in volume. Compared with the previous month, exports of passenger cars decreased by 4 percent in both value and in volume.

Imports of minerals decreased by 13 percent in value and by 2 percent in volume compared with the same period last year. Compared with the previous month, imports of minerals increased by 5 percent in value and by 4 percent in volume.

Imports of mineral fuels and electric current decreased by 31 percent in value and by 4 percent in volume compared with the same period last year. Within this product area, imports of crude petroleum oils decreased by 33 percent in value and by 3 percent in volume. Compared with the previous month, imports of crude petroleum oils increased by 2 percent in value and by 9 percent in volume.

Imports of machinery/transport equipment decreased by 6 percent in value while they remained unchanged in volume compared with the same period last year. Within this product area, imports of passenger cars increased by 25 percent in value and by 27 percent in volume. Compared with the previous month, imports of passenger cars increased by 3 percent in value and by 4 percent in volume.

Definitions and explanations

The value index and the volume index describe nominal and real value trends over time. The real value trends describe trends in which price changes have been removed. The indices refer to chain indices with base year 2015=100.
